Understanding Registered Agents

A official agent acts as a vital connection between a company and the state in which it functions. In Washington, every company or limited liability company is required to designate a designated agent. This individual or organization is charged for receiving crucial legal documents, such as tax-related communications and lawsuits, on behalf of the firm. By having a official agent in Washington, companies can ensure adherence with regional regulations and maintain good standing.

The designated agent must have a tangible address in the state and be accessible during normal business hours to accept these documents. This role is essential not only for legal compliance but also for protecting the company's privacy. Instead of using a personal address, companies can list their designated agent, which helps shield business owners from having their information publicly disclosed. This provides a level of safety and credibility, especially for startups and new ventures.

Moreover, choosing a trustworthy designated agent is crucial for prompt notifications and replies to legal matters. In the state, designated agents must send any received documents to the business without delay. Failing to react to legal notifications can result in severe consequences, including default judgments or penalties. Therefore, a qualified registered agent acts as a protector against possible legal challenges, allowing business owners to concentrate on running their business rather than legal issues.

Common Misconceptions About Designated Agents

Many business professionals assume that designated agents are solely necessary for big organizations or firms that do business across various states. This is a common myth. In truth, any business entity, irrespective of size or scope, needs a registered agent. In the state of Washington, every kind of entity, including sole traders, LLCs, and corporations, must appoint a designated representative to guarantee they get vital legal papers and notifications.

Another prevalent myth is that designated agents are only responsible for collecting state mail. While it is accurate that a designated agent in the state of Washington serves as a point of contact for legal correspondence, they also play a pivotal role in maintaining compliance with local regulations. Registered agents help entities stay informed about crucial deadlines, such as completing annual reports or renewing licenses, which can prevent legal issues down the line.

Some business owners assume that they can serve as their personal designated representative without any issues. While this is permissible, it may not necessarily the ideal choice. Serving as your own state of Washington registered agent means you must be present during regular working hours to receive documents. This can lead to overlooked communications if you are not around or away from the workplace.
